Fashion Starlet: Alexa Chung


British television personality/model Alexa Chung at the Whitney Museum Fall Gala wearing Versace. The stylista is known for her play of garments of high price designers of Chanel to low price point retailers as Topshop and H&M that distinguish her looks from many other celebs. The London beauty insist that her natural style won't be influenced to drastically by her New York City environment in which she recently moved too for upcoming ventures in her career. Known as Vogue's "It" girl for her play of fashion she dismisses it as " something hard to live up too." After modeling for four years she gave it up in pursuit of a fashion journalism career instead. In June 2009 she became one of British Vogue's contributing editors.

Designer Spotlight: DVF


With the invention of the knitted "wrap dress" that sky rocketed her fashion career into the hangers of every women's closet, Diane Von Furstenberg has been one of the most inspiration designers since the likes of CoCo Chanel, and Estee Lauder . Born in Europe, the Parisian inspired designer had her start in the fashion industry with just a dream of designing for everyday women and a suit case full of her collection when she walked into the office of Vogue to showcase her talent. With criticism and with a muster of hope in 1970 she started her line Diane Von Furstenberg with a 300,000 dollar bugdet that eventually over time multipled into a million dollar company with multiple lisencing in luggage, home decor, cosmetics, and sportswear. " I have yet to meet a woman that wasn't strong. They don't exist." she stated as her mission for her designs. With her signature prints along with soft silhouettes, blends of textures, and play of colors , the designer makes it known that she is a designer for women that want to "feel like women". In the designers recent Spring 2010 collection, she folics in a play of knitted executions with pops of greens, with neutral tones of black mixed in. The designer has continued to become a continual favorite for many women and she will forever be known for her " dress" that set her mark as being the master of prints.

Fashion Stylist : June Amberose


Graduating with a degree in Marketing with her first job for a corporate America Investment Bank firm, June Amberose sought out for more than just the average job. The 33 year old explaines to the fashion bomb, "I was always interested in clothing. When I was in elementary school, I created our first school fashion show. I got everyone involved, whether we were making pocketbooks out of crepe or skirts out of construction paper." Her keen eye for fashion and spirit landed her as a fashion stylist for Jive Records where she did music groups and photo shoot spreads for the label. In the beginning she didn't even know what a fashion stylist did. “I was a sponge and OK with learning as I went. It was my passion and everything that I did. I wanted to know where clothes came from before they went to stores. I dreamt, lived, and breathed fashion.” The author of ." Effortless Style", continues to work for massive of celebrity clientale in the fashion industry known for dressing Ciara, Kelly Ripa, and Jay-Z.

Designer Spotlight: Rachel Roy




Rachel Roy, a Manhatten based designer, execution of design and texture has opened her an upcoming spot as one of the few rising designers of the century. Starting her fashion career off since the age of 14 years old she graduated with a degree in communications and then moved to New York City to pursue a fashion career. She eventually landed an internship with Rocawear clothing line where she was promoted to Creative Director. In 2005 she expanded her avenue of design to create her very own fashion sense of design. "Accessible fashion is very important to me, and I believe every woman should get the opportunity to express herself through style. I have wanted to design a fashion forward yet affordable collection since I was young. With this collection I focused on accenting women’s best features while keeping the clothes edgy and youthful", she tells Afrobella.com. Her massive choices of textures and silhouettes are trendy and youthful with a touch of power in representation. There is a statement to be made in her pieces that drives an inner force of fashion escape. Recently, the mother of two has expanded her line in contract with Macy's stores with a more afforable price point for the women she designs for. "I knew the price points for the collection would be affordable no matter where it was sold, and the team at Jones Apparel Group and I were both so impressed and honored by Macy’s support. We completely saw eye to eye in how we wanted this collection to look and in what ways we would position it to customers." Her collection, design eye and style are very promising and more is anticipated from the designer in the future.
